On the flip side, there are some beans that are very high in oxalate. If you have high urine oxalate, it is best to avoid these beans. 1. Great Northern Beans (66mg per 1/2 cup) 2. Navy Beans (76mg per 1/2 cup) 3. White Beans (66mg per 1/2 cup) 4. Soybeans (48mg per 1/2 cup) 5. Black Beans (62mg per 1/2 cup) See more First, who should focus on low oxalate beans? Not everyone needs to follow a low oxalate diet. Only people who have high urine oxalate need to limit high oxalate foods.(1) A 24-hour … See more Some may wonder why not just avoid all beans on a low oxalate diet? WebNov 1, 2005 · Since absorbed dietary oxalate can make a significant contribution to urinary oxalate levels, oxalate from legumes, nuts, and different types of grain-based flours was analyzed using both enzymatic and capillary electrophoresis (CE) methods. Total oxalate varied greatly among the legumes tested, ranging from 4 to 80 mg/100 g of cooked weight. WebSep 1, 2004 · The 2 methods for correcting for endogenous oxalate indicated that oxalate absorption during 6 hours after oxalate ingestion was significantly higher for almonds (treatments 1 and 2) than for black beans (treatments 3 and 4) (p <0.05).
